Abstract

Tailored for the WLAN,we propose a cross-layer resource allocation schemes based on multi-packet reception.Firstly,the condition of sharing the subchannel by more than one user is obtained.Secondly,the subchannel allocation scheme including "exclusive" and "share" modes are proposed.Finally,the expression of power and bit loading which meets the QoS requirement is derived.Analysis and simulation show that proposed scheme not only improves the system throughput efficiently but also reduces the average packet delay and has low computational complexity.

Key words

WLAN / multi-packet reception / cross-layer design / MIMO-OFDM / distributed coordination function protocol
